What It Is To Misspeak In America

Megyn Kelly, the new star on Broadway on Fox has come under fire just now for making comments about the ethnicity of Santa Claus. I believe that the media and various and sundry advocacy groups should leave Ms. Kelly alone but not for the reasons that you may think. Firstly, Megyn Kelly must be under a tremendous amount of pressure. She has been promoted on Fox to a Cadillac time slot and a few days ago appeared on the Tonight Show with Jay Leno. Maybe she misspoke. It is obvious at least to me that it was not a good subject to bring up in these troubling times. Perhaps her producers did not foresee the backlash or thinking out loud it could have been an extemporaneous hole digging. Whatever the case she seems like a good person and did not mean any harm. After all, look at all the misspeaks and sex scandals we allow our politicians to get away with and they still go back to their desks shortly. What Megyn said should have been exited from any media script but served as chump change compared to what else we have experienced lately.
